ADS1294读取寄存器和数据手册不对应
时间:10-02
整理:3721RD
点击:
读ADS1294的寄存器,CONFIG2的结果是0x00,但是按照数据手册应该是0x40才对,而且奇怪的是只有CONFIG2不对,其他的位都对,怀疑是ADS1294没有复位,后来添试了软件复位和硬件复位,读出来的结果如下图。
但是按照数据手册上,CONFIG2应该是0x40才对。
尝试了重新写入CONFIG2, 为0x40,然后再读出就可以,难道是ADS1294的数据手册有误?
再次写入 40, 读出就正常了. 说明通信和数据传输是没有问题了,
那么除了复位的过程的问题, 是不是还有其他的原因, 比如有可能其他的写操作错误地写入了这个地址
你好,你读取到了采集的AD值吗?我现在也在做ADS1294,读取其寄存器正常,但是读取通道值是固定的,现在只是输出两个通道的数值,分别是状态字:C0 00 C0,通道1:C0 C0 C0 ,通道2:00 C0 00